Overview
- Kick-off is 8:10pm UK time on Saturday 15 November at the Aviva Stadium, live on TNT Sports 1 with streaming via discovery+ on Amazon Prime Video.
- Ireland start Mack Hansen at full-back and Sam Prendergast at fly-half, with prop Paddy McCarthy making his Test debut and Stuart McCloskey returning in midfield.
- Australia recall James O'Connor at No 10, Len Ikitau at inside centre and Allan Alaalatoa at tighthead, with Rob Valetini back in the pack under captain Harry Wilson.
- Australia arrive after a 26-19 defeat to Italy and five losses in their last six Tests, while Ireland follow a 26-13 loss to New Zealand and an unconvincing 41-10 win over Japan.
- Recent history favours Ireland with four straight wins over Australia, each decided by five points or fewer, and betting lists the hosts as strong favourites.
